What Are Foundation Problems?

Foundation problems are issues that occur within the structural base of your home, leading to potential damage throughout the entire building. These issues often result from soil movement, water damage, or poor construction practices. Common types of foundation problems include settling, where parts of the foundation sink or shift, and cracking, which can weaken the structural integrity of your home.

Understanding these problems is the first step in protecting your home. Foundation problems can lead to severe structural damage, safety hazards, and even a decrease in your property’s value. That’s why it’s essential to know what to look for and address these issues as soon as they arise.

Common Causes of Foundation Problems

Foundation problems can arise from a variety of factors, including:

  • Soil Conditions: Different types of soil can expand or contract, causing the foundation to shift. Clay soils, for example, are known for their high expansion rate when wet and shrinkage when dry, which can lead to foundation movement.

  • Water Damage: Poor drainage around your home can lead to water pooling around the foundation. Over time, this water can cause the soil to erode, leading to foundation settlement and cracks.

  • Poor Construction Practices: If the foundation was not properly constructed or if the soil was not adequately compacted, it could lead to problems as the home settles over time.

These are just a few examples of what can go wrong, but the key takeaway is that your foundation is susceptible to various environmental and structural factors. Being aware of these causes can help you prevent problems before they start.

Identifying Early Signs of Foundation Problems

Recognizing the early signs of foundation problems can save you a lot of trouble down the road. Here are some of the most common indicators to watch for:

Visual Signs Inside the Home

Cracks in Walls and Floors:

  • Not all cracks are cause for concern, but when you start to see horizontal cracks in walls or diagonal cracks running from corners of doors or windows, it’s time to take action. These cracks often indicate that the foundation is shifting or settling unevenly.

Doors and Windows That Stick:

  • If you notice that your doors and windows are suddenly difficult to open or close, it could be a sign that your foundation is shifting. As the foundation moves, it can cause the frames to become misaligned, leading to sticking doors and windows.

Sagging or Uneven Floors:

  • Floors that are not level or that sag in certain areas are a clear sign of foundation problems. This issue often results from the foundation settling unevenly, causing the floor to dip or bow.

Exterior Signs to Watch For

Cracks in Exterior Walls:

  • Just like the cracks you see inside, cracks on the exterior of your home can be a sign that your foundation is in trouble. Pay special attention to cracks around windows and doors, as these are often the first places to show signs of foundation movement.

Gaps Between Windows and Walls:

  • If you start to see gaps forming between your windows and the surrounding walls, it’s a sign that your foundation is shifting. These gaps can allow water and pests into your home, leading to further damage.

Leaning Chimney:

  • A leaning chimney is a significant indicator of foundation problems. If you notice that your chimney is pulling away from your home or appears to be tilting, it’s essential to have it inspected immediately.

Other Indicators of Foundation Problems

Persistent Moisture and Water Damage:

    • Moisture in your basement or crawl space is more than just an annoyance; it can indicate that your foundation is not properly sealed. Over time, this moisture can lead to mold, mildew, and further foundation damage.

Musty Smells and Mold:

  • If you notice a musty smell in your basement or crawl space, it could be a sign that there is excessive moisture in the area. This moisture can lead to mold growth, which is not only harmful to your health but also a sign of potential foundation problems.
